#このチュートリアルの動作環境: Windows7 システム、PHP7.1 バージョン、DELL G3 コンピューター合計する 2 つの方法: 1. 配列を走査し、要素を追加して合計します。構文は "for($i=0;$i
php は計算します。配列要素の合計メソッド
php で配列要素の合計を計算する方法は多数ありますが、この記事では 2 つの合計メソッドを紹介します。方法 1. トラバーサル配列、要素を 1 つずつ追加して合計します。
配列をトラバースする一般的な方法は、for ループ(配列のインデックス付けに使用)とforeach ループ##です。 #(インデックス配列と連想配列の両方が可能です)。 例 1: for ループの合計
<?php $array= array(1,2,3,4,5,6,7,8,9,10); $sum=0; $len=count($array);//数组长度 for ($i=0; $i < $len; $i++) { $sum+=$array[$i]; } echo '1 + 2 + 3 +...+ 9 + 10 = '. $sum; ?>
例 2: foreach ループの合計
<?php header('content-type:text/html;charset=utf-8'); $array= array(1,2,3,4,5,6,7,8,9,10); $sum=0; foreach ($array as $value) { $sum+=$value; } echo '数组所有元素之和:'. $sum; ?>
##実際、PHP には配列要素の合計を求める組み込み関数 --array_sum()
<?php header('content-type:text/html;charset=utf-8'); $array= array(1,2,3,4,5,6,7,8,9,10); echo '数组所有元素之和:'. array_sum($array); ?>
#拡張知識:
PHP には、配列要素の合計を求める組み込み関数 (array_sum()) があるだけでなく、配列要素の積を見つけるための組み込み関数 --array_product () PHP ビデオ チュートリアル " 以上がPHPで配列の要素の合計を求める方法の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。<?php
header('content-type:text/html;charset=utf-8');
$array= array(1,2,3,4,5,6,7,8,9,10);
echo '数组元素的乘积:'. array_product($array);
?>